using System;
using System.Collections.Generic;
using Akka.Actor;
using Akka.Streams.Stage;
using Amazon.Kinesis;
using Amazon.Kinesis.Model;
namespace Akka.Streams.Kinesis
{
internal sealed class KinesisSourceStage : GraphStage<SourceShape<Record>>
{
#region messages
sealed class GetShardIteratorSuccess
{
public readonly GetShardIteratorResponse Response;
public GetShardIteratorSuccess(GetShardIteratorResponse response)
{
Response = response;
}
}
sealed class GetShardIteratorFailure
{
public readonly Exception Cause;
public GetShardIteratorFailure(Exception cause)
{
Cause = cause;
}
}
sealed class GetRecordsSuccess
{
public readonly GetRecordsResponse Response;
public GetRecordsSuccess(GetRecordsResponse response)
{
Response = response;
}
}
sealed class GetRecordsFailure
{
public readonly Exception Cause;
public GetRecordsFailure(Exception cause)
{
Cause = cause;
}
}
sealed class Pump
{
public static readonly Pump Instance = new Pump();
private Pump() { }
}
#endregion
#region logic
sealed class Logic : TimerGraphStageLogic
{
private readonly ShardSettings _settings;
private readonly Outlet<Record> _out;
private readonly IAmazonKinesis _kinesisClient;
private string _iterator;
private readonly Queue<Record> _buffer = new Queue<Record>();
private StageActor _actor;
private IActorRef _self;
public Logic(KinesisSourceStage stage) : base(stage.Shape)
{
_settings = stage.Settings;
_out = stage.Outlet;
_kinesisClient = stage._clientFactory();
SetHandler(_out, onPull: () => _self.Tell(Pump.Instance));
}
public override void PreStart()
{
_actor = GetStageActor(AwaitingShardIterator);
_self = _actor.Ref;
GetShardIterator();
}
private void GetShardIterator()
{
var request = new GetShardIteratorRequest
{
ShardId = _settings.ShardId,
StreamName = _settings.StreamName,
ShardIteratorType = _settings.ShardIteratorType
};
if (_settings.AtTimestamp.HasValue)
request.Timestamp = _settings.AtTimestamp.Value;
_kinesisClient.GetShardIteratorAsync(request)
.PipeTo(_self,
success: result => new GetShardIteratorSuccess(result),
failure: ex => new GetShardIteratorFailure(ex));
}
private void AwaitingShardIterator((IActorRef actorRef, object message) args)
{
switch (args.message)
{
case GetShardIteratorSuccess s:
_iterator = s.Response.ShardIterator;
_actor.Become(AwaitingRecords);
RequestRecords(_self);
break;
case GetShardIteratorFailure f:
Log.Error(f.Cause, "Failed to get a shard iterator for shard {0}", _settings.ShardId);
FailStage(f.Cause);
break;
}
}
private void RequestRecords(IActorRef self)
{
_kinesisClient.GetRecordsAsync(new GetRecordsRequest
{
Limit = _settings.Limit,
ShardIterator = _iterator
}).PipeTo(self,
success: result => new GetRecordsSuccess(result),
failure: ex => new GetRecordsFailure(ex));
}
private void AwaitingRecords((IActorRef actorRef, object message) args)
{
switch (args.message)
{
case GetRecordsSuccess s:
var records = s.Response.Records;
if (string.IsNullOrEmpty(s.Response.NextShardIterator))
{
Log.Info("Shard {0} returned a null iterator and will now complete.", _settings.ShardId);
CompleteStage();
}
else
{
_iterator = s.Response.NextShardIterator;
}
if (records.Count > 0)
{
foreach (var record in records)
_buffer.Enqueue(record);
_actor.Become(Ready);
_self.Tell(Pump.Instance);
}
else
{
ScheduleOnce("GET_RECORDS", _settings.RefreshInterval);
}
break;
case GetRecordsFailure f:
Log.Error(f.Cause, "Failed to fetch records from Kinesis for shard {0}", _settings.ShardId);
FailStage(f.Cause);
break;
}
}
private void Ready((IActorRef actorRef, object message) args)
{
if (args.message is Pump)
{
if (IsAvailable(_out))
{
Push(_out, _buffer.Dequeue());
_self.Tell(Pump.Instance);
}
if (_buffer.Count == 0)
{
_actor.Become(AwaitingRecords);
RequestRecords(_self);
}
}
}
protected override void OnTimer(object timerKey)
{
if ("GETRECORDS" == (string)timerKey)
RequestRecords(_self);
}
}
#endregion
public ShardSettings Settings { get; }
private readonly Func<IAmazonKinesis> _clientFactory;
public KinesisSourceStage(ShardSettings settings, Func<IAmazonKinesis> clientFactory)
{
Settings = settings;
_clientFactory = clientFactory;
Shape = new SourceShape<Record>(Outlet);
}
public Outlet<Record> Outlet { get; } = new Outlet<Record>("Records.out");
public override SourceShape<Record> Shape { get; }
protected override GraphStageLogic CreateLogic(Attributes inheritedAttributes) =>
new Logic(this);
}
}
